Security

The BMW Digital Key is a efficient way to start your vehicle. The fob is compatible with your Apple Watch or smartphone and is compatible with BMW Connected Drive. It can unlock the car and start the engine. It also allows you to share the key with up to five others.

The key fob transmits encrypted signals with the vehicle. It is therefore difficult for hackers and cloners to intercept the signal. The UWB technology of the BMW Digital Key also prevents attacks on relays even if the device is moving. The system also incorporates an inbuilt alarm system to block unauthorized starts and disables the ignition switch, which is a common target for thieves.

BMW also offers a variety of security options available including Passive Start, which disables the starter motor when the key fob is not in close proximity to the car. This feature is offered on a number of BMW models and can provide additional security.

Some people choose to carry their BMW key fob in a pouch that blocks signals, which reduces the risk of a third-party broadcasting the signal that identifies the fob and using it to gain access to the car. Some prefer a standard key case, that does not come with this feature, but it will protect the fob from scratches.

Some BMW owners have reported that their cars were stolen by criminals using a signal amplifier to increase the signal strength of the identifying signals. This kind of attack is referred to as "Relay Attack" and can be prevented by keeping the key fob in a signal blocking pocket or by installing a signal blocker app on your phone.
